If My Book Is Ever a Film – A girl can dream, right?
When I saw this question pop up, I just had to answer it. Who would I like to see play my characters? Funny thing is, when I look for images of my characters, I deliberately avoid those of celebrities and opt for unknown models from stock photos instead. After the characters get more developed, though it gets a little easier to pick out who’d play my characters best. It’s every author’s dream to see their characters live on the big screen, right? Gosh, I hope so, or I am indeed weird.
So let’s get this show on the road.
Lucy Gregory is the heroine from Demons Prefer Blondes. She’s a no-nonsense, quite sarcastic, hairstylist who just happens to be a half-succubus. She doesn’t discover this, however, until she accidentally unleashes a legion of demons in her suburban hair salon. She’s got shoulder length, stylish hair and greenish-gold hazel eyes. She’s beautiful, but not full of herself. Matter of fact, she doesn’t really see herself as beautiful at all—until her transformation, that is. Then there is no denying her steamy sensuality. Jessica Biel would make a great Lucy. She’s played some straight-forward, sarcastic roles and has the look I saw Lucy having. And we can’t deny that Jessica is gorgeous.
Now, for Rafe. This is going to be a little trickier. He’s pretty stony and reserved. He’s got a muscular body with shoulder-length, uber-gorgeous dark hair. To make things even more complicated, he’s got silver eyes. Thank god for contacts—and hair dye, of course. I could totally see Australian actor Dustin Clare playing Rafe Deleon. For those who are unfamiliar with Dustin, he plays Gannicus on Starz’s Spartacus Gods of the Arena. The penetrating gaze in this picture says it all.Yummy, right?
I even found someone who could play my bad guy, Belial, the leader of the Infernati. Belial has blonde hair and can be swank and debonair. He’s attractive, if you can get past the stench of brimstone that clings to him. As much as I love Paul Bettany, he can definitely play a bad guy. Who can forget that creepy performance in The Davinci Code?
